Modern Omnichannel Media Orchestration: Integrating Traditional and Digital Mix

August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Harmonizing the Full Advertising Spectrum for Compounded Growth

Sustainable market leadership is achieved through the disciplined orchestration of an omnichannel media strategy that unites the cultural scale of traditional broadcast and print with the precision targeting of digital channels. Media executives must break down organizational silos between brand marketing and performance media. Deploying unified econometric modeling ensures every dollar invested across diverse media formats works in compounding harmony to maximize customer lifetime value.

Siloed media management leads to severe budget inefficiencies, message fragmentation, and distorted attribution reporting. When performance teams optimize solely for short-term last-click conversions while brand teams focus entirely on unmeasured broad reach, overall growth stagnates. Unifying the media mix into a single strategic continuum creates sustained top-of-funnel brand salience while maintaining high bottom-of-funnel conversion velocity.


The Strategic Roles of Traditional and Digital Media Assets

Traditional broadcast television, linear radio, high-impact out-of-home, and premium print publications continue to deliver unparalleled simultaneous mass reach and cultural authority. These formats establish immediate trust, baseline brand recognition, and broad societal awareness that digital channels cannot easily replicate in isolation.

Conversely, digital media channels, such as programmatic display, paid search, social commerce, and retail media networks, excel at dynamic segmentation, immediate customer activation, and precise behavioral retargeting. When traditional media builds widespread brand awareness, downstream digital search volumes surge and conversion acquisition costs decline, proving the synergistic relationship between mass and targeted channels.


Advanced Marketing Mix Modeling and Incrementality Testing

Relying on digital multi-touch attribution (MTA) models creates an inherent bias toward bottom-of-funnel capture channels while systematically undervaluing broadcast and offline touchpoints. Privacy regulations, browser cookie deprecation, and cross-device signal loss have further weakened the reliability of digital user tracking.

Leading organizations resolve this challenge by implementing modern, privacy-resilient Marketing Mix Modeling (MMM) paired with continuous incrementality testing. Bayesian statistical MMM algorithms analyze historical media expenditures, macroeconomic variables, seasonal fluctuations, and baseline sales trends. This allows media leaders to calculate the true incremental sales lift generated by each media channel, optimizing budget allocation across the total advertising portfolio.


Unified Creative Sequencing and Brand Continuity

An omnichannel strategy requires strict visual, sonic, and conceptual continuity across all customer touchpoints. Fragmented messaging across disjointed creative agencies dilutes brand equity and confuses prospective buyers.

The central campaign message must be adapted specifically to fit the mechanical constraints and consumer mindsets of each medium. A high-impact thirty-second broadcast commercial sets the broad emotional narrative; localized DOOH screens reinforce the core visual branding during daily commutes; podcast host reads explain detailed product advantages; and targeted paid search ads provide the direct transactional conversion mechanism. This unified sequencing guides the consumer seamlessly through the decision journey.


Agile Capital Allocation and Cross-Channel Governance

Static, annual media plans that lock media budgets into rigid channel silos are obsolete in volatile market environments. Modern media governance structures implement dynamic capital reallocation frameworks that adjust spending dynamically based on real-time market opportunities and performance signals.

Media directors must conduct regular cross-channel reviews, shifting funds toward platforms exhibiting high marginal return on investment while tapering spend in saturated channels encountering diminishing returns. Maintaining strategic flexibility across the total advertising media portfolio ensures resilient, profitable growth across changing consumer landscapes.


Establishing Unified KPIs and Executive Accountability

Creating cross-channel alignment requires replacing fragmented channel metrics with unified business outcome KPIs. Tracking blended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C), Marketing Efficiency Ratio (MER), and Customer Lifetime Value (LTV) ensures all media teams work toward enterprise profitability.

When media managers share common performance objectives rather than competing for channel attribution credit, advertising media investments transform into a predictable, scalable revenue generation engine capable of driving sustainable long-term enterprise value.


Future-Proofing Media Strategy Against Market Volatility

Media channel dynamics fluctuate rapidly with consumer behavioral shifts and technology developments. Building an adaptable media framework requires maintaining a continuous innovation budget dedicated to emerging media testing.

Allocating ten to fifteen percent of overall media capital toward nascent platforms, new ad formats, and experimental data partnerships ensures the organization stays ahead of market transitions. This disciplined balance between proven media anchors and experimental discovery creates a resilient competitive advantage.

Search Engine Marketing Architecture: Scalable Paid Search and Intent Capture

August 18, 2026August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Capturing High-Value Commercial Intent at the Microsecond of Search

Search Engine Marketing (SEM) remains the premier digital media channel for capturing active, high-intent consumer demand. To build a dominant search engine strategy, advertisers must unify automated smart bidding systems, comprehensive first-party conversion data feeds, and rigorous negative keyword governance. This combination ensures media capital is concentrated exclusively on high-margin queries that drive measurable commercial pipeline.

Unlike display or social advertising, which relies on predictive audience matching to generate interest, paid search operates as a pull medium. Consumers explicitly declare their immediate requirements, product preferences, and buying readiness through query keywords. Aligning paid search architecture with these declared intent signals produces the highest conversion rates and shortest sales cycles in digital media.


Smart Bidding Strategies and Conversion Value Optimization

Manual keyword-level bidding has been completely superseded by automated, machine-learning smart bidding algorithms. Modern search engines evaluate thousands of real-time contextual signals during each auction, including device hardware, browser locale, historical query patterns, and immediate search context.

Marketers must shift their bidding targets from basic volume maximization or simple cost-per-acquisition (CPA) metrics toward Target Return on Ad Spend (tROAS) and Conversion Value Optimization. By integrating backend customer lifetime value (LTV) and gross profit margin data into the search engine via offline conversion tracking, bidding algorithms automatically bid aggressively on high-value enterprise prospects while reducing spend on low-margin transactional buyers.


Balancing Broad Match Capabilities with Strict Negative Governance

Deploying broad match keywords enables search algorithms to discover unexpected, high-converting query variations that rigid exact-match structures miss entirely. However, unmanaged broad match strategies can rapidly deplete media budgets on irrelevant, low-intent search terms.

A successful search architecture balances broad match coverage with exhaustive, continuously updated negative keyword lists. Media managers must audit search term reports weekly, identifying and excluding non-commercial terms, informational troubleshooting queries, and competitor brand variants that generate traffic without sales intent. This disciplined governance preserves ad spend for high-probability commercial keywords.


Responsive Search Ads and Asset Customization

Responsive Search Ads (RSAs) utilize machine learning to assemble the optimal combination of headlines and descriptions based on individual searcher intent. Rather than writing static copy, advertisers must provide diverse asset pools comprising emotional hooks, technical specifications, competitive differentiators, and strong calls to action.

To achieve superior ad rank and Quality Scores, ad copy must dynamically reflect the searcher’s exact query terminology. Utilizing dynamic keyword insertion, countdown timers for promotional urgency, and location insertion parameters ensures maximum copy relevance. High Quality Scores reduce actual cost-per-click rates while securing dominant top-of-page placements over competing bidders.


Landing Page Experience and Conversion Rate Synchronization

An immaculate paid search campaign can fail entirely if the post-click destination suffers from poor UX or misaligned messaging. Media teams must maintain strict message match between search ad copy and landing page content.

Landing pages must deliver rapid load speeds, clear value propositions above the fold, verified social proof, and streamlined form structures. Implementing server-side personalization to dynamically adjust landing page headlines to match the originating search query elevates user engagement and drives substantial conversion lift, maximizing the efficiency of every paid search dollar.


Search Audience Layering and First-Party Remarketing Lists

Paid search reaches peak performance when keyword intent is enhanced with audience signals. Layering First-Party Customer Match lists and Remarketing Lists for Search Ads (RLSA) allows advertisers to tailor bid aggression based on historical relationship depth.

Existing customers searching for renewal or expansion products can be presented with customized loyalty incentives, while prospective buyers receive introductory value messaging. This audience-informed search strategy optimizes bid value, ensuring high customer acquisition efficiency across competitive search auctions.


Defending Brand Equity Against Competitor Search Bidding

Competitor encroachment on proprietary brand search terms represents an ongoing revenue risk. Rival brands frequently bid on your brand name to capture high-intent users navigating directly to your platform.

Maintaining a continuous branded search defense strategy guarantees top search real estate, protects customer acquisition costs, and allows full control over sitelinks and promotional callouts. While brand clicks may appear redundant, the cost of losing high-converting brand traffic to agile competitors far exceeds the nominal investment required to secure the top ad placement.

Social Media Advertising: Algorithmic Feed Optimization and Social Commerce

August 18, 2026August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Dominating Algorithmic Feeds Through Creative Velocity

Paid social media advertising is no longer governed merely by narrow audience parameter selections, but by algorithmic creative relevance, dynamic catalog integrations, and frictionless social commerce checkouts. Modern growth marketers must deploy broad targeting parameters paired with high-velocity creative testing frameworks. This strategy allows platform machine learning algorithms to locate high-converting audience micro-segments at the lowest possible acquisition costs.

Legacy social ad playbooks relied on hyper-targeted demographic overlays that restricted delivery and inflated CPMs. Contemporary social ad networks have evolved: their predictive algorithms analyze user engagement signals, video watch durations, and interaction velocity to determine optimal ad delivery. Brands that feed platforms high volumes of diverse, authentic creative assets consistently outperform competitors using restrictive targeting matrices.


Short-Form Video Architecture and Creative Fatigue Management

Short-form vertical video formats dominate consumer attention across major social networks. Capturing market share across these feeds demands creative production designed specifically for the platform environment. The first two seconds of video content must feature an immediate visual hook, unexpected motion, or bold text proposition that halts user scrolling behavior.

Creative fatigue represents an ongoing operational challenge in high-spend social campaigns. Once an ad set reaches high frequency, click-through rates decline while cost per acquisition spikes. High-performing media teams establish continuous content production engines, testing dozens of hook variations, narrative angles, and visual formats every week to maintain low blended acquisition costs.


User-Generated Content and Creator Partnership Amplification

Polished, high-budget studio advertisements often underperform within social feeds because users immediately identify and skip commercial messaging. User-Generated Content (UGC) and creator-led assets mirror native organic social content, creating higher viewer retention and establishing authentic social proof.

Marketers maximize the impact of creator collaborations by deploying creator whitelisting and partnership ads. This allows brands to run paid dark posts directly from the creator’s social handle, targeting custom audiences while leveraging the creator’s authentic credibility. This hybrid approach unites organic influencer authenticity with the precise bidding and attribution controls of paid social ad managers.


Frictionless In-App Social Commerce Infrastructure

The traditional e-commerce conversion path, which redirects users from social apps to external website landing pages, introduces significant drop-off friction. Native social commerce stores and in-app checkout solutions eliminate external redirects, allowing consumers to discover, evaluate, and purchase products seamlessly within the native social platform.

Brands must integrate real-time inventory catalogs, automated customer service messaging, and single-click payment wallets into their social media storefronts. Reducing transactional steps increases conversion rates and captures impulse purchasing demand directly at the point of digital discovery.


Privacy-Preserving Measurement and First-Party Signal Integration

Platform privacy shifts and mobile operating system restrictions have significantly degraded client-side pixel tracking accuracy. Relying on standard web browser pixels results in underreported conversions and compromised algorithm optimization.

Modern social advertisers must deploy server-to-server Conversions APIs (CAPI) and Advanced Matching protocols. Passing first-party customer transaction data directly from secure cloud servers into ad platform machine learning engines restores conversion signal fidelity. This enriched data feed enables social algorithms to accurately optimize bidding strategies and target lookalike models based on actual customer lifetime value.


Managing Marginal Returns and Scaling Social Spend

Scaling paid social budgets requires monitoring the marginal cost per acquisition rather than aggregated blended averages. As spend increases, audiences experience saturation, leading to rapid performance decay.

Media planners must implement automated budget reallocation rules that shift spend between top-of-funnel creative prospecting, middle-of-funnel consideration assets, and dynamic product catalog retargeting. Diversifying across multiple social platforms prevents algorithmic dependency and insulates media performance against sudden platform policy shifts.


Building Agile Creative Testing Frameworks

A structured creative sandbox allows marketing teams to test radical visual concepts with minimal capital risk. By allocating a dedicated percentage of total social media spend to low-budget experimental ad sets, brands identify viral breakout creative angles before deploying heavy media weight behind them.

Systematically categorizing top-performing hooks, visual styles, and copy frameworks builds a repeatable repository of creative intelligence. This scientific approach eliminates guesswork from social ad creation and drives consistent, scalable performance gains.

Native Advertising and Sponsored Editorial Content Integration

August 18, 2026August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Engaging Audiences Through Seamless Editorial Synergy

Native advertising delivers high-value promotional messaging that mirrors the visual design, tone, and functional user experience of the host publication. To succeed with native media, advertisers must prioritize deep informational value over aggressive direct-response pitches. Delivering authoritative analysis, industry data, and practical solutions within the editorial flow earns consumer trust and drives significant brand lift.

Traditional intrusive banner formats frequently trigger banner blindness and ad-blocking software, resulting in declining click-through rates and high bounce metrics. Native advertising dissolves these barriers by meeting consumers in an active content-consumption mindset. Readers engage with native units as authentic editorial material, resulting in dwell times and engagement rates that far exceed standard digital display inventory.


Programmatic In-Feed Units and Content Discovery Platforms

The native advertising ecosystem operates across two distinct delivery mechanisms: programmatic in-feed ad units and content discovery recommendation widgets. In-feed units integrate directly into the article streams of premier news sites and social feeds, adopting the typography and layout of the publisher platform.

Content discovery widgets positioned at the footer of articles leverage algorithmic recommendation engines to suggest related sponsor content to highly engaged readers who have completed reading an article. Media planners must optimize native headlines and featured imagery continuously, balancing curiosity-driven click-through rates with editorial credibility to avoid deceptive clickbait traps.


Custom Content Studios and Co-Branded Long-Form Journalism

Premium publishers operate internal content studios that collaborate directly with brand marketers to produce custom long-form articles, white papers, interactive data visualizations, and investigative reports. These co-branded pieces position the advertiser as a forward-thinking industry authority while providing tangible value to the publication’s discerning readership.

To maximize the return on custom editorial investments, brands must ensure the content addresses core industry pain points rather than serving as a thinly veiled product manual. Incorporating expert interviews, proprietary survey data, and transparent problem-solving frameworks elevates the sponsored piece into essential reading material that naturally drives organic social sharing and high dwell times.


Regulatory Transparency and FTC Disclosure Compliance

Trust is the central currency of native advertising. Attempting to disguise commercial intent through obscure or ambiguous labeling inevitably leads to consumer backlash and regulatory penalties. The Federal Trade Commission and international advertising standards authorities strictly mandate conspicuous disclosure labels, such as Sponsored Content, Paid Advertisement, or Partner Studio.

Maintaining clear visual disclosures does not degrade campaign conversion performance. In fact, research demonstrates that informed consumers who actively choose to read transparently labeled high-value sponsored material exhibit higher brand favorability and purchase intent than users who feel misled by deceptive advertising formatting.


Evaluating Down-Funnel Conversion and Editorial Dwell Time

Evaluating native media requires moving beyond superficial impressions and basic click counts. Primary performance indicators must include average active dwell time, scroll depth percentage, social amplification, and subsequent on-site brand search volume.

Media teams must track post-click content consumption journeys. When a user transitions from a native publication piece to a brand landing page, attribution tools should measure lead generation, newsletter signups, and long-term pipeline progression. Aligning native content with clear mid-funnel nurture workflows ensures that broad editorial interest converts directly into measurable commercial pipeline.


Scaling Native Content Distribution Across Vertical Networks

Producing exceptional editorial content represents only half the challenge; achieving adequate distribution scale is equally critical. Media buyers must syndicate native articles across specialized industry publication networks using programmatic content delivery platforms.

By matching editorial subject matter with niche trade publications, brands reach hyper-targeted B2B decision makers and premium consumer segments with minimal wasted circulation. Automated A/B testing of headlines and thumbnail visuals across syndication endpoints ensures sustained engagement throughout extended multi-month publishing campaigns.


Repurposing Editorial Assets for Cross-Channel Synergies

High-performing native editorial assets should not exist in isolation on third-party publisher websites. Marketers can extract core insights, data graphics, and expert pull-quotes to fuel organic social channels, executive LinkedIn posts, and email nurture streams.

This repurposing maximizes content production return on investment, transforming a single sponsored journalistic feature into dozens of modular content pieces that continuously reinforce brand authority across every digital touchpoint.

Digital Audio and Podcast Advertising: Monetizing Intimate Listener Attention

August 18, 2026August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Capitalizing on Screen-Free Immersive Media Consumption

Digital audio and podcast advertising offers direct access to focused, highly engaged audiences during screen-free moments throughout their daily routines. To achieve superior performance across streaming audio channels, media planners must combine dynamic ad insertion technology with personalized host endorsements and contextual genre alignment. This unlocks scalable reach without sacrificing the authentic conversational tone that makes audio media uniquely persuasive.

In an increasingly saturated visual media landscape, visual ad fatigue and banner blindness have steadily reduced display conversion rates. Digital audio bypasses visual clutter entirely, engaging listeners during daily commutes, physical exercise, household chores, and focused work sessions. Brands that integrate digital audio into their omnichannel media architecture capture undivided auditory attention and build deep emotional trust.


Dynamic Ad Insertion Versus Baked-In Endorsements

The podcast advertising ecosystem is split between two primary execution models: baked-in native reads and dynamic ad insertion (DAI). Baked-in reads embed the host endorsement directly into the permanent audio track, ensuring lifetime exposure whenever past catalog episodes are downloaded. However, baked-in ads lack geographic targeting flexibility, real-time frequency management, and programmatic agility.

Dynamic Ad Insertion (DAI) resolves these constraints by dynamically serving audio spots at the moment of file download or live stream request. DAI allows media buyers to target listeners by current location, device type, listener demographics, and historical listening preferences. This enables brands to rotate promotional offers, test seasonal creative variants, and run time-sensitive campaigns across entire podcast networks simultaneously.


Programmatic Streaming Audio and Audience Segmentation

Streaming audio platforms, including music streaming services and digital radio networks, provide massive reach paired with deep behavioral targeting parameters. Through programmatic audio buying, advertisers target users based on curated mood playlists, music genres, activity tracking, and cross-device listening habits.

A fitness brand can programmatically deliver high-energy motivational audio spots to listeners streaming workout playlists during early morning hours, while financial services brands can align with business news podcasts during weekday market open hours. The lack of competing on-screen visual banners ensures an ad completion rate that consistently exceeds ninety percent across premium streaming environments.


Audio Creative Engineering and Sound Architecture

Audio creative requires specialized production techniques distinct from television or digital video sound design. The absence of accompanying visuals demands clear brand identification within the first five seconds of playback, complemented by a distinct sonic brand identity or mnemonic chime.

Scripts must be written for conversational authenticity rather than corporate formality. When deploying host-read ads, providing key talking points and personal product experience guidelines yields far higher conversion lift than forcing hosts to read rigid corporate scripts verbatim. Clear, simple web addresses and short promotional codes reduce friction for listeners transitioning from audio consumption to mobile conversion.


Attribution Modeling in Auditory Environments

Audio attribution has advanced through the integration of household IP matching, vanity promotional URLs, dedicated promo codes, and post-listen web pixel tracking. When a listener streams an ad, audio attribution SDKs link the exposure to subsequent website visits, shopping cart additions, and mobile app installations occurring on connected household devices.

Media planners must also implement holdout market testing and promo code redemption tracking to calibrate baseline organic lift against paid audio channels. This comprehensive attribution strategy validates digital audio as a robust customer acquisition engine capable of driving sustainable customer lifetime value.


Scale Management Across Fragmented Podcast Hosting Platforms

A major operational hurdle in digital audio is media fragmentation across hundreds of independent podcast hosting servers and listening apps. Media buyers must utilize specialized podcast ad networks and supply-side platforms that aggregate inventory across disparate distribution channels.

Standardizing reporting protocols via IAB Podcast Measurement Guidelines ensures consistent delivery auditing, filtering out robotic automated crawler downloads from genuine human audio streams. This rigorous supply verification ensures that every audio advertising dollar is invested into verified listener impressions.


Developing Sonic Brand Assets for Long-Term Recall

Visual logos dominate digital design, yet auditory triggers create faster neural recognition. Forward-thinking brands engineer proprietary audio mnemonics, customized brand voices, and recognizable soundscapes across all audio campaigns.

Consistently deploying these sonic assets across streaming audio, connected television, and physical retail spaces creates immediate audio recall. When a consumer hears the distinct brand chime, brand familiarity and purchase consideration are instantly activated without requiring visual confirmation.

Digital Out-of-Home Advertising: Geospatial Targeting and Programmatic DOOH

August 18, 2026August 19,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Transforming Public Spaces into Dynamic Media Channels

Digital Out-of-Home (DOOH) advertising has evolved from static roadside billboards into an intelligent, programmatic media format capable of real-time adaptation and precise geospatial targeting. Advertisers maximize their outdoor return on investment by shifting from rigid fixed-duration leases to audience-based programmatic DOOH buying. This ensures impressions are purchased exclusively when verified high-density target segments congregate near physical screen networks.

Traditional billboard leasing suffered from static creative constraints, inflexible multi-week contracts, and generalized circulation estimates. Programmatic DOOH disrupts this legacy model by integrating mobile location telemetry, ambient environmental triggers, and instant creative swapping. Brands achieve massive unskippable public visibility while retaining the surgical targeting flexibility of digital performance channels.


Harnessing Mobile Geospatial Intelligence for Screen Planning

Modern DOOH planning relies on aggregated, anonymized mobile device location data to construct accurate hourly movement profiles around outdoor digital displays. Rather than assuming static demographic averages, media planners analyze when target affinity groups, such as corporate professionals, fitness enthusiasts, or international travelers, pass specific roadside, transit, or retail screens.

This geospatial intelligence enables conditional impression buying. Instead of paying for 24-hour continuous playback, media algorithms trigger ad delivery only during peak audience density windows. This dynamic scheduling dramatically reduces impression waste and concentrates advertising budgets during moments of maximum pedestrian and vehicular dwell time.


Contextual Triggers and Environmental Dynamic Creative

Programmatic DOOH screens can ingest live external API feeds to adjust creative messaging in real time. Dynamic triggers include local meteorological conditions, traffic congestion levels, sporting event outcomes, and financial market movements.

For example, a beverage brand can automatically serve hot coffee promotions when outdoor temperatures dip below freezing, instantly transitioning the creative to iced drinks when ambient temperatures rise. This acute contextual relevance captures spontaneous consumer attention in public spaces, driving immediate foot traffic to nearby retail distribution outlets.


Integrating DOOH with Omnichannel Retargeting

Outdoor media should never operate in isolation from personal mobile devices. When DOOH displays serve impressions to a public crowd, mobile advertising IDs within the screen’s viewshed can be mapped to geographic geofences.

Marketers utilize this data to create sequential mobile retargeting pools. Consumers who were exposed to a large-format DOOH screen in an urban transit hub can subsequently receive complementary mobile display, social, or audio ads during their evening commute. This coordinated cross-channel reinforcement solidifies brand recall and accelerates purchasing decisions.


Measuring Foot Traffic Lift and Real-World Conversion Outcomes

Proving the physical impact of out-of-home media no longer relies on subjective recall surveys. Advanced location analytics platforms provide rigorous footfall attribution studies that measure real-world conversion lift.

By establishing control groups of consumers with identical demographic and movement profiles who were not exposed to the DOOH screens, media analysts isolate the exact percentage increase in retail store, dealership, or restaurant visits driven by the outdoor campaign. This empirical data elevates DOOH from a purely speculative top-of-funnel tactic to an accountable performance driver.


Programmatic Deal Structuring for Outdoor Inventories

Executing programmatic DOOH requires selecting the proper transaction mechanism. While open exchange bidding offers immediate flexibility, private marketplace (PMP) deals and programmatic guaranteed contracts secure guaranteed access to high-impact landmark screens in prime metropolitan locations.

Establishing direct PMP relationships with screen operators guarantees price predictability while maintaining programmatic triggers based on foot traffic density and weather changes. This hybrid approach combines the reliability of traditional outdoor contracts with the automated optimization of digital media buying.


Creative Adaptation for High-Impact Large-Format Displays

Designing visuals for physical outdoor displays demands distinct creative considerations compared to web screens. DOOH assets must convey message comprehension within three to five seconds from significant viewing distances.

High-contrast color palettes, bold sans-serif typography, and minimal text copy ensure visual legibility under direct sunlight or nighttime artificial illumination. Avoiding complex visual clutter ensures that spontaneous passerby glances convert immediately into lasting brand impressions.


Hardware Innovations and 3D Anamorphic Installations

The physical hardware underpinning DOOH has advanced with ultra-high-definition LED resolutions and curved corner display architectures. Anamorphic 3D creative illusions create hyper-realistic sensory depth that captivates street-level crowds and sparks viral organic social media sharing.

While anamorphic displays require specialized 3D modeling and precise viewing angle engineering, their earned media value regularly outpaces standard flat placements. Blending striking physical engineering with programmatic media distribution transforms standard outdoor advertising into cultural spectacle.

High-Ticket Client Acquisition Frameworks for Digital Service Firms

August 18,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Digital agencies and professional consultancies frequently struggle with inconsistent revenue because they pitch commoditized services instead of quantifiable business outcomes. Selling general design, copywriting, or development hours forces you into price competition with global marketplaces. To consistently close high-ticket retainers and five-figure advisory contracts, your agency must position itself as an operational profit partner by diagnosing high-friction business problems and offering structured, risk-mitigated transformation plans.

The Downfall of Hourly Billing and Scope Ambiguity
Billing by the hour actively punishes operational efficiency and creates misaligned incentives between you and your client. If your team solves a complex infrastructure bottleneck in two hours using superior expertise, billing for two hours leaves significant value on the table while incentivizing slow delivery.

Transition your agency entirely to fixed-price value packages or performance-aligned retainers. Price your engagements based on the financial upside generated or the costly operational disaster prevented, rather than the raw labor hours expended.

The Diagnostic Discovery Process
Never send a formal proposal after a brief introductory conversation. Elite service firms conduct structured discovery audits that interrogate the prospective client’s operational data, existing revenue bottlenecks, and past vendor failures.

Frame your discovery calls as strategic diagnostic sessions. Ask direct questions: What is the exact cost of inaction if this system remains broken? What internal blockers derailed previous attempts to fix this? By guiding the client to articulate the financial reality of their problem, you establish the baseline value for your upcoming proposal.

Structuring the Risk-Reversal Proposal
A winning high-ticket proposal does not present an endless checklist of deliverables. It outlines a clear three-phase execution roadmap:
– Phase One: Technical Audit and Root Cause Isolation
– Phase Two: System Architecture and Controlled Implementation
– Phase Three: Operational Optimization, Team Enablement, and Performance Verification

Include precise milestone definitions and define explicit client obligations to prevent scope creep. Remove purchase hesitation by offering staged milestone authorizations or clear performance-backed commitments.

Institutionalizing Client Referrals
The most predictable acquisition channel for specialized agencies is an engineered referral ecosystem. At the moment of maximum customer satisfaction, such as the successful rollout of a major milestone, execute a formal client review and ask for warm introductions to peer executives facing similar operational challenges.

The Strategic Shift from High-Volume Content to Search Intent Resolution

August 17,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Publishing massive volumes of generic informational content to attract search traffic is an obsolete strategy. Modern search engines and intelligent discovery platforms prioritize direct answers, information gain, and authoritative user experience over raw word count and repetitive keyword matching. To capture high-value organic traffic that converts into paying customers, online businesses must design content architectures that solve specific search intent within the first three hundred words of user engagement.

Why the Old Content Playbook Fails
For years, digital marketing agencies promoted the creation of long, repetitive articles padded with obvious definitions and generic filler paragraphs. This approach wastes reader attention and frustrates search engine users who want immediate answers. When a prospective buyer searches for an operational solution, they do not need three paragraphs defining basic industry terms. They need actionable frameworks, benchmark data, and specific execution steps immediately.

The Inverted Pyramid for Digital Publishing
Adopt an inverted pyramid structure for all business publishing assets. Place the primary solution, core technical takeaway, and executive summary at the very top of the page. By delivering instant value upfront, you lower bounce rates, increase reader trust, and position your brand as a decisive authority.

Use the subsequent sections of your document to elaborate on advanced nuances, operational edge cases, implementation risks, and practical case examples. Structure your layout with clear bold section divisions to allow technical decision-makers to scan directly to relevant operational details.

Mapping Content to Commercial Search Intent
Every piece of published content must serve a distinct purpose within the customer acquisition journey:
– Informational intent must provide original technical analysis and unique research data.
– Navigational intent must offer frictionless pathways to core tools, calculators, and documentation.
– Commercial and transactional intent must present objective comparisons, transparent pricing breakdowns, and tangible implementation proof.

Original Insights and Information Gain
Search algorithms actively reward information gain, which represents the net-new data, distinct perspectives, or proprietary case results that your page provides compared to existing indexed documents. Interview internal subject matter experts, publish internal platform metrics, and share candid operational post-mortems. Original data cannot be easily duplicated, ensuring that your search presence remains durable against automated copycat sites.

Building Defensible Digital Moats in the Age of Commodity Tools

August 16,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

When the barrier to creating digital products, content, and software approaches zero, sheer production speed ceases to provide a competitive advantage. Anyone can spin up an online storefront, launch automated content feeds, or build wrapper applications in an afternoon. To construct an enduring online enterprise, you must build structural digital moats rooted in proprietary data assets, non-replicable community distribution, and deep workflow integration.

The Illusion of Speed as a Competitive Moat
Many digital entrepreneurs mistake agility for defensibility. Launching fifty products in a single quarter or publishing hundreds of programmatic web pages may yield short-term traffic spikes, but it creates zero long-term enterprise value. If your business model can be fully replicated by a competent team with standard automated tooling within forty-eight hours, your pricing power will degrade rapidly as competitors enter your niche.

Proprietary Data and Feedback Loops
The strongest digital barrier you can build is a proprietary data asset that improves with scale. When your platform processes specialized industry transactions, captures nuanced user feedback, or compiles rare operational benchmarks, you create a private dataset that competitors cannot scrape or synthesize.

Integrate this proprietary data directly into your core user experience. Provide clients with customized industry intelligence, predictive workflow optimizations, and performance comparisons that become more accurate as your total user volume expands. This dynamic creates high switching costs, because leaving your platform means abandoning cumulative organizational intelligence.

Ecosystem Integration and Workflow Lock-In
True defensibility emerges when your product transitions from an optional tool into an operational backbone. Integrate deeply with your customers’ essential third-party software, internal databases, and regulatory compliance reporting pipelines. When replacing your solution requires migrating thousands of legacy records, retraining entire operational departments, and risking operational downtime, your annual retention metrics rise dramatically.

Audience Ownership and Distribution Sovereignty
Relying entirely on third-party discovery algorithms or paid ad networks leaves your business vulnerable to sudden platform policy changes. True digital distribution defensibility requires building direct, owned communication channels. Cultivate private community forums, dedicated email subscriber networks, and direct relationships with key industry stakeholders. When you control your distribution pipeline, you protect your business against algorithmic disruptions.

Enterprise B2B SaaS Churn Reduction and Retention Architecture

August 15, 2026 tangoessentials No Comments

Product churn in subscription software is rarely a customer success failure; it is an onboarding and product-market alignment failure. When enterprise accounts fail to renew, the decision was made during the first thirty days of their contract cycle. The solution to structural revenue leakage is establishing deterministic time-to-value milestones, tracking granular feature adoption velocity, and enforcing executive sponsor alignment before contract deployment finishes.

The True Root Cause of Subscription Attrition
Software companies frequently misdiagnose cancellations by relying on exit surveys. Customers do not leave because of minor price adjustments or missing edge-case features. They leave because your software failed to deliver the operational outcome promised during sales demos. If an enterprise buyer cannot demonstrate measurable return on investment to their internal stakeholders within the first quarter, your contract becomes an easy target during budget reviews.

Deterministic Onboarding and Time-to-Value
Stop treating onboarding as a passive self-guided tutorial. High-retention software businesses implement prescriptive customer onboarding with mandatory technical milestone sign-offs. Map out the exact technical integration steps required for the client to achieve their first high-impact workflow completion. Designate this moment as Value Milestone One.

Every day that passes between contract signature and Value Milestone One increases the probability of first-year cancellation by double-digit percentages. Assign dedicated implementation engineers to remove technical friction, configure single sign-on integrations, and import legacy datasets proactively.

Product Telemetry and Early Warning Signals
Relying on scheduled quarterly business reviews to detect dissatisfaction is a fatal operational error. You must monitor real-time product telemetry for leading indicators of account decay. Red flags include a sudden drop in daily active users relative to purchased seats, an absence of administrative logins over a fourteen-day window, or frequent support tickets tagged with core workflow errors.

When telemetry detects usage deceleration, customer success teams must trigger proactive intervention playbooks immediately. Do not ask if the client needs help; schedule a strategic workflow audit to realign software capabilities with their current executive objectives.

Securing Expansion and Net Revenue Retention
A truly resilient subscription company maintains a Net Revenue Retention (NRR) rate exceeding one hundred and ten percent. Achieve this by tying pricing tiers directly to value metrics, such as processed transaction volume, managed customer records, or automated compute tasks, rather than arbitrary user seat counts. As your customer scales their operations using your infrastructure, your contractual revenue expands organically.
